The Hidden Cost of Trying to Figure Everything Out Alone
Many people focus on the price of coaching but forget to consider the cost of remaining stuck.
Staying in a career that no longer challenges or fulfills you can affect much more than your paycheck. It can gradually reduce your motivation, confidence, productivity, and overall quality of life.
The hidden costs often include:
- Missed promotions and leadership opportunities
- Ongoing career burnout and stress
- Lower confidence when making important decisions
- Delayed career growth
- Feeling frustrated despite working hard
In many cases, the cost of waiting is much greater than the cost of investing in professional coaching.

Career Coaching Helps You Avoid Costly Career Mistakes
One decision can change the direction of your career.
Accepting the wrong job, staying too long in an unhealthy work environment, or passing up leadership opportunities because of self-doubt can delay your professional growth for years.
Career coaching provides an outside perspective that helps you evaluate opportunities more objectively.
Instead of making decisions based on fear or uncertainty, you learn to make choices that align with your long-term goals and personal values.
